How to easily activate Samsung Secure Folder
Creating a secure folder on a Samsung phone is very easy, requiring only a few taps on the Galaxy phone's screen.
Step 1: Tap "Settings" on your Samsung phone. Then, find and select the section related to "Biometrics and Security". Next, select "Security Folder".
Step 2: Here, log in to your Samsung account and choose a password to protect the folder. There are three security methods: pattern, PIN, and passcode. After completing the process, the folder will be operational on your phone.
How to quickly use Samsung Secure Folder
Here's how to use Samsung's secure folder to easily manage your information.
Step 1: Click on the software in the folder, then click the plus icon to add the application.
Step 2: Alternatively, to move files or images, go to where they are stored, press and hold the file you want to move. Then, tap the three dots and tap the option for a secure folder.
Step 3: If you want to change the location of an app within the secure folder, press and hold the app icon, then drag and drop it to the desired location.
